Governments-backed Medical Organization Plans to Eliminate Malaria with Blockchain by 2030
Main page News, Tech, Asia, Blockchain, Future

M2030, a humanitarian organization, initiated by Asia Pacific Leaders Malaria Alliance (APLMA), has announced its partnership with Dragonchain to use distributed ledger in a fight against malaria.

The main goal of the organization is to eliminate malaria in Asia by 2030, highlights the announcement.

Alongside Dragonchain support, M2030 wants to transparent the supply chain of contributors, while also allowing organizations to track the use of contributions by implementing partners.

Co-Founder of M2030, Patrik Silborn, claims that blockchain technology will help enhance the trust in M2030.

Dragonchain is a U.S.-based blockchain tech, which develops enterprise services, entertainment, education and project incubation solutions. It was initially developed by Disney in 2014.
